Russia’s Customs Union Technical Regulations
The Russia-Kazakhstan-Belarus Customs Union (CU) released its Technical Regulations on Food Product Labeling; it comes into force on July 1, 2013.

Indonesia Officially Recognizes Safety Control System of the U.S.
On January 3, 2013, Indonesia’s Ministry of Agriculture officially recognized Safety Controls of U.S. Fresh Food of Plant Origin.

Turkey’s Annual Citrus Report
This report gives the production and export predictions along with local policy changes regarding citrus. Citrus production in Turkey is predicted to decrease due to poor weather conditions.

Japan Proposes New MRLs for Phenthoate and New Additives
The Government of Japan (GOJ) announced that it intends to apply changes to the Maximum Residue Levels (MRLs) for phenthoate and approved two new food additives. The Embassy comment period ended on Wednesday, December 26, 2012. Before the changes go into effect, there will be a domestic public comment period and the GOJ will notify the WTO.

Israel’s Annual Citrus Report
This report outlines Israel’s citrus production and exports in the marketing year 2012/13. The report shows that Israel’s production is up 3 percent from the last marketing year along with increased exports.

China’s Canned Deciduous Fruit Annual Report
This report gives the production and consumption totals of China’s canned deciduous fruit. China’s production of canned peaches and pears has decreased while its consumption of canned peaches has increased.

China’s Annual Tree Nut Report
This report gives the forecasted production totals for walnuts and almonds in China, which are expected to maintain the same totals despite an increase in acreage due to favorable weather conditions and government support.
To view the report, click here.
China’s Annual Potatoes and Potato Products Report
This report gives the forecasted production totals for China’s fresh potato production, which has decreased by two percent. However, China’s frozen French fry production continues an upward trend due to increasing demand, which will continue to increase the demand for U.S. frozen French fry exports.

China’s 2013 Tariff Rates for Agricultural Commodities
The State Council Duty Committee (SCDC) released its 2013 tariff rate duties for certain commodities, with a January 1, 2013, effective date. This report contains an unofficial translation of the SCDC announcement, including tables on import duties for tariff rate quotas, specific and compound duty rates, and tentative tariff rates.

India Publishes Procedures for New Product Approval
This report highlights the “New Product Approval Procedure” published by The Food Safety and Standards Authority of India (FSSAI) on December 11, 2012. The new procedure supersedes all previous advisories and clarifications issued by FSSAI.

Japan’s Annual Citrus Report
This report outlines Japan’s citrus production and imports in the marketing year 2012/13. The report shows changes in Japanese consumer preferences that show opportunities for sweeter citrus varieties.
